Event Organizer’s Checklist

Planning and running an event in Faculty of Medicine spaces involves a few key steps. Use this guide to make sure your event goes smoothly. 


Before Your Event

  • Book your resources (academic learning spaces, FoM Zoom) using RoomFinder and include service requests as needed (e.g., recording, technical support.) 
  • Confirm that you’ve received a booking confirmation via email from the Resource Coordination Team. 
  • Disseminate site access information for your participants and presenters at all locations. 
  • If using videoconferencing, share Zoom details (Meeting ID digits, passcode) with participants in advance. 
  • Check technology and equipment needs early. If you or your presenters are unfamiliar with the room technology, in-room user training is available — visit the In-Room User Training webpage to learn more or submit a request. 
  • Identify a backup person who can assist or take over coordination if you’re unavailable. 
  • Confirm all event requirements. Certain sites require additional steps for catering, custodial, security, or other support services if your booking is after-hours. Contact the Resource Coordination Team for more information. 

During Your Event

  • Arrive early to set up and test audio/visual equipment. 
  • Check your connections: 
    • Ensure all videoconference sites or hybrid participants are connected. 
    • Verify that everyone can see and hear clearly. 
  • Test presentation materials to make sure they display correctly at all locations. 
  • Contact the MedIT Service Desk (1-877-266-0666, option 2) immediately if you experience technical difficulties. 
  • Start on time and make sure the session stays within your booked time slot. 

After Your Event

  • End the session on schedule so the next group may start their session on time. 
  • If videoconferencing, end the Zoom meeting so the call disconnects and recording (if applicable) is ended at an appropriate time. 
  • Leave the room clean and tidy and remove any personal items or garbage. 
  • Report any issues (technical, custodial, or facility-related) to the Resource Coordination Team or MedIT Service Desk. 
  • Provide feedback if you encounter recurring issues or have suggestions for improving event support.
